Understanding Houston's Unique Roof Challenges
Houston, known for its unique climate and diverse architectural landscape, presents specific challenges when it comes to roof maintenance. The city’s unpredictable weather patterns, including intense storms and frequent rainfall, can take a toll on roofs, leading to leaks, damage, and eventual replacement. Additionally, the area’s high humidity levels contribute to mold and mildew growth, which not only compromises indoor air quality but also necessitates regular inspections and repairs.

The Step-by-Step Guide to Prolonging Your Roof's Lifespan Through Maintenance and Repairs
Maintaining your Houston roof is an investment in your home’s longevity and value. Here’s a step-by-step guide to help you extend its lifespan through regular care and prompt repairs:
1. Regular Inspections: Start by scheduling annual or semi-annual inspections with a qualified roofer. They can identify minor issues like missing shingles, leaks, or damage from storms before they escalate into costly repairs.
2. Clean and Maintain: After each inspection, clear debris from gutters and drains to prevent clogging, which can lead to water damage. Repair or replace any loose or damaged shingles immediately. Regular washing of the roof with a soft brush and mild detergent helps remove dirt and algae buildup that can compromise its protective layer.
3. Fix Leaks Promptly: Address leaks promptly to avoid extensive interior damage. Localized leaks might be caused by faulty flashing, damaged shingles, or blocked gutters. Houston’s unpredictable weather makes timely repair crucial to preserving your roof.
4. Re-sealant and Coatings: Apply re-sealant to protect the roof’s underlayment from moisture. Consider using reflective coatings to reduce heat absorption, thereby lowering cooling costs. These steps can significantly extend your roof’s life in our region’s diverse climate.
